According to "Kentucky Ancestors" Vol. 10, pages 94-97, my ancestor, Daniel Lamson MORRISON (1776-1860) is buried in Old Elmwood Cemetery, Owensboro in the plot with a married daughter, Elizabeth Pigman Morrison CHAMBERS and William W. CHAMBERS, Martha A. CHAMBERS and Sarah CHAMBERS. Last week we passed through Owensboro and visited Elmwood Cemetery to search for the burial site. We found the cemetery without any trouble due to the great directions provided by members of this mailing list. Many thanks to each of you! The Elmwood-Rosehill Cemetery office has a record of the burial of the above listed CHAMBERS family members in Section E, Lot 8 in the historical section of Old Elmwood Cemetery. They have no record for Daniel Lamson MORRISON, but I was told that is not unusual, that many of the old burials prior to the Civil War are not in their cemetery records. We were given a map of the layout of the cemetery and located Section E, Lot 8. We found it centrally located, mowed and well maintained but completely vacant, not one single stone on the lot. There were stones on the adjacent lots, but there was a large, vacant grassy area exactly where my family was supposed to be. We returned to the cemetery office to ask questions. The lady working in the office was very sweet but could not provide any information. She suggested that perhaps the stones had been destroyed by a tornado that hit the cemetery a couple of years ago, that many broken stones had been carted away.
